Penentuan Modulus Elastisitas Kayu Menggunakan Sonic Wave Analyzer
Determination of wood modulus elasticity by using the experimental method with Sonic Wave Analyzer (SOWAN) has been demonstrated. The wood samples consist of five types of wood. Wood samples were formed in cylindrical shape with a length of 15 cm and a diameter of 4.5 cm. After that, the time delay of primary wave and secondary wave was measured. The research result showed that the largest primary and secondary wave velocity was varnish wood by vp = 31.52 x 103 m/s and vs = 7.76 x 103 m/s respectively. Modulus elasticity values obtained was E = 6.426 x 109 N/m2. The smallest of primary and secondary wave velocity was Sengon wood by vp = 2.14 x 103 m/s and vs = 1.63 x 103 m/s respectively and modulus elasticity values obtained was E = 0.667 x 109 N/m2.
